CloudStack是一个开源的云平台,用于创建和管理云基础设施。以下是如何使用CloudStack的简要步骤:
安装CloudStack
1. 准备工作:确保你的服务器满足CloudStack的硬件要求。
2. 安装操作系统:在服务器上安装Linux操作系统,如CentOS或Ubuntu。
3. 安装Java:CloudStack依赖于Java,确保安装了Java环境。
4. 安装CloudStack:从CloudStack官网下载安装包,按照安装向导进行安装。
配置CloudStack
1. 配置数据库:CloudStack使用数据库来存储数据,如MySQL。
2. 配置网络:配置网络参数,如IP地址、子网等。
3. 配置存储:配置存储资源,如iSCSI、NFS或本地存储。
登录CloudStack管理界面
1. 打开浏览器,输入管理界面的URL,如 `https://yourserver:8080/client`。
2. 使用管理员账户登录。
创建和管理云资源
1. 创建数据中心:在“数据中心”下创建数据中心。
2. 创建区域:在数据中心下创建区域。
3. 创建主机:在区域下创建主机,用于运行虚拟机。
4. 创建虚拟机:在主机下创建虚拟机。
5. 创建网络:创建内部网络、外部网络等。
6. 创建ISO:上传ISO文件,用于虚拟机的安装。
7. 创建模板:创建虚拟机模板,用于快速部署虚拟机。
其他功能
监控:监控虚拟机、主机、网络等资源。
备份和恢复:备份虚拟机,并在需要时恢复。
用户管理:创建和管理用户账户。
注意事项
安全性:确保你的CloudStack环境具有足够的安全性,如防火墙、SSL等。
备份:定期备份重要数据,以防数据丢失。
更新和升级:定期更新和升级CloudStack,以保持系统稳定和安全。
这只是CloudStack使用的一个简要概述,具体操作可能因版本和配置而有所不同。建议参考官方文档和教程,以获取更详细的信息。